Abstract
The invention relates to a component (1) for installing a room closing element made of hollow glass blocks (2, 3) using mortar or concrete and a suitable reinforcement. The component (1) according to the invention consists of two hollow glass blocks (2, 3), which are designed identically and preferably lie one next to the other, with an intermediate spacer (4) which seals the intermediate space between the glass blocks (2, 3) and is preferably assembled from multiple spacers (5, 5b, 5c) designed as hollow bodies that are separated from one another by intermediate films (6a, 6b) with coatings (7a, 7b). The component (1) is characterized by a comparatively large structural depth which ensures very good insulation values despite the small surface area of the glass blocks (2, 3). The structural depth also increases the geometrical moment of inertia with respect to bending, said moment of inertia allowing for large proportions of insulating mortar/concrete and components with large dimensions.
